Following the Sex Pistols' breakup in 1978, Lydon spent three weeks in Jamaica with Virgin Records head Richard Branson, in which Lydon assisted Branson in scouting for emerging reggae musicians. Branson also flew American band Devo to Jamaica, with an aim to installing Lydon as lead singer in the band. Devo declined the offer. Upon returning to England, Lydon approached Jah Wobble (né John Wardle) about forming a band together. The pair had been friends since the early 1970s when they attended the same school in Hackney. They had previously played some music together during the final days of the Sex Pistols. Both had similarly broad musical tastes, and were avid fans of reggae and world music. Lydon assumed, much as he had with Sid Vicious, that Wobble would learn to play bass guitar as he went. While that had proven a fatal assumption with Vicious (Lydon cites his musical inability as a prime reason for the Pistols' breakup), Wobble would prove to be a natural talent. Lydon also approached guitarist Keith Levene, with whom he had toured in mid-1976, while Levene was a member of The Clash. Lydon and Levene had both considered themselves outsiders even within their own bands. Jim Walker, a Canadian student newly arrived in the UK, was recruited on drums, after answering an ad placed in Melody Maker. PiL began rehearsing together in May 1978, although the band was still unnamed. In July 1978, Lydon officially named the band "Public Image" (the "Ltd." was not added until several months later), after the Muriel Spark novel The Public Image. PiL debuted in October 1978 with "Public Image", a song written while Lydon was still a member of Sex Pistols.[4] The single was well received and reached number 9 on the UK charts, and it also performed well on import in the US. In 1984, Lydon started to put together a new touring band and auditioned various musicians at The Palace in Pasadena, California. Among the prospective recruits was Flea, soon to be of Red Hot Chili Peppers fame. After a storming jam session, Flea was immediately offered the job, but he declined, stating that he was a big fan of the Flowers of Romance album and only wanted to jam with the band. PiL manager Larry White spent around a week trying to persuade him to change his mind, telling him: "Listen, this Chili Peppers thing is going nowhere. The best thing you can do is come out with PiL!" Keith Levene later claimed: "Flea auditioned, but when he found out I wasn't in the band anymore, he just said no. I was quite pleased by that!" However, Flea has stated that he did not join because he wanted to do his own thing and not be part of a sideshow. In 1986, Lydon recruited former Magazine and Siouxsie & the Banshees guitarist John McGeoch, world music multi-instrumentalist (and former Damned guitarist) Lu Edmunds, bass guitarist Allan Dias, and former The Pop Group and The Slits drummer Bruce Smith. As the years went on, PiL's line-up grew steadier as the sound of the albums drifted toward dance culture and drum-oriented pop music. Edmunds left due to tinnitus in 1988, and Smith left in 1990. PiL released Happy? in 1987, and during the spring of 1988 performed throughout the United States as part of the INXS Kick tour. The album was less well received by critics than its immediate predecessor, but still produced the classic single "Seattle". In 1989, PiL toured with New Order and The Sugarcubes as "The Monsters of Alternative Rock", an arrangement of disparate alternative bands that predated the Lollapalooza festival by two years. PiL's ninth album, 9, appeared earlier that year. I ran into John in New York when I was on tour with Bad Manners in the 90's. He was pleasant and upbeat!He was flogging album. The band's last album to date, 1992's That What Is Not, included a sample from the Sex Pistols' song "God Save the Queen" in which the young Lydon's voice is heard chanting the words, "No future, no future..." Lydon disbanded the group a year later after Virgin records refused to pay for the tour supporting the album, and Lydon had to pay for it out of his own pocket. The band's last concert was performed on September 18, 1992 with the lineup of Lydon, McGeoch, Ted Chau (guitar, keyboards), Mike Joyce of The Smiths (drums), and Russell Webb (bass). Lydon released a solo album, Psycho's Path, in 1997. Families enjoying the Blessed Sacrament School Carnival, this October 16,17 and 18 will also enjoy participating in a unique attempt at a Guinness World Record. The Carnival, will include rides, games, and food from all of the international traditions that make up the Blessed Sacrament Parish Community. In addition, Liborio’s, the leading maker of Salvadorian and Central American food will attempt to equal or exceed the Guinness record for the largest pupusa, ever made. Pupsas are a Salvadorian delicacy made of corn flour, cheese, regional vegetables, and specially spiced meat.

You can participate and join in the fun by eating a part of the pupusa, after it has been made. Set up of the Pupuseria will begin the final day of the carnival, Sunday Oct. 18th @ 9am. That is an event in itself. The pupusas will be sold all afternoon and evening. All proceeds going to Blessed Sacrament.

Thank you Liborio’s market! Record or not, this is guaranteed to be delicious and fun for every member of the family. The Blessed Sacrament Carnival also has Ferris wheels, wild rides, games and plenty of other family oriented activities.

The Carnival is conducted in the security of the parish campus, and is designed for families, large and small. When the family needs to refuel, they can chose from exquisitely prepared food from Mexican, Filipino, Eastern European and American born cooks, each providing their national cuisine. The diversity of Blessed Sacrament Parish is displayed through the fine food their families prepare and serve. It is a truly International food event. Entertainment is also provided throughout the weekend, with bands and performers from Latino and Anglo musical genres, and a Raffle , which will have a GRAND PRIZE OF $5,000. Only $1. To purchase a raffle ticket to win $1,000 or $2,000 or $5,000 being the grand prize. Not necessary to be there to win.

Blessed Sacrament Parish and School is located at 6657 Sunset Boulevard.

The campus of the parish is transformed into a fairgrounds, and operates from 6 to 11 on Friday, 4 to 11 on Saturday, and 11 A.M. to 9 P.M. on Sunday. All proceeds go to the Blessed Sacrament Church School, which won a grant from the Archdiocese, this year, and is using the grant to develop a much needed pre-school.
